Factors to Consider When Choosing an Anxiety Therapist in Rockford, IL

Searching for therapists in Rockford starts with knowing what kind of support you want. Many people look for therapy for anxiety, depression, grief, relationship challenges, life transitions, or work stress. As you compare Rockford therapists, look for someone whose listed specialties and approach match your needs. A therapist’s bio can help you understand their experience, communication style, and what to expect in sessions.

In a mid-sized city like Rockford, your best fit may be near Riverside, Coronado, East State, or available through virtual sessions. In-person therapy can be helpful if you prefer a set office location, while virtual therapy may fit better if your schedule changes or local options are limited. You can also narrow your search by appointment availability, whether a therapist is accepting new patients, session structure, and whether a free phone consultation is offered.

Therapy in Rockford can be a significant investment without insurance. Using in-network insurance is one of the most reliable ways to reduce session costs and understand what you may pay before you book.
